Transaction 631588d512a60f940ab2ab349321a4a9760c69b55995a4438d4aff4e5e412e53

100 Input
1 Outputs
  • 631588d512a60f940ab2ab349321a4a9760c69b55995a4438d4aff4e5e412e53:0
  • value  46358
    address  bc1qg4d4xzhd5x4shqs60m6rtsqff3g6g0klhr80sw